J&K Sports Council’s website not yet updated, LG’s directions go unheeded
12/13/2019 6:20:28 PM

Jammu, Dec 13
The directions of Jammu and Kashmir Lieutenant Governor Girish Chander Murmu remain unheeded as the State Sports Council--the prominent body handling sports affairs in the Union Territory--has yet to update its official website.
The last updates can be seen on the official website ‘jksportscouncil.com’ is of month of July 30, 2019 and thereafter nothing official besides happenings across the regions—are seen updated.
“Internet services were snapped in the valley in the month of August in view of abrogation of Article 370 and 35-A and at that time, Darbar Move offices were in Srinagar,” official sources here said.
“As no sports activity was conducted for the past more than two months in Kashmir valley in view of restrictions due to which, the website could not be updated,” an official claimed.
He said that due to snapped internet and restrictions, sports remained affected and following this, nothing could be updated.
However, sources in the State Sports Council told UNI that broadband internet facility was not suspended in Jammu and the exercise of updating the website could have been performed from Jammu based head office.
“Barring first two weeks of August, sports activities continued on regular basis in Jammu,” they said adding that the happenings could have been updated on the website.
Sources further said that regular training sessions of coaches, district, state level competitions, national championships, happened in the past two months in Jammu but none of the activity has been updated.
"Besides routine happenings, the list of coaches with discipline and credentials, functioning of associations, are also yet to be updated," they added.
“Apart from activities, the photographs, list of coaches, orders, news has also not been updated on the website,” they added.
Lieutenant Governor, Girish Chandra Murmu on November 19 has directed the General Administration Department to advise all departments to update all Government websites with latest information and content week’s time and also asked the department to come up with delivery of citizens’ services via mobile application as well to strengthen the public service delivery mechanism.
